What is a Slack Channel?
A Slack Channel is a designated location to post specific types of communications depending on the purpose of the channel.
A Slack Channel is characterized with a "#" in front if the topic name for the kind of conversation that should happen in that channel.
What is the difference between a DM and a Channel?
A Slack DM can be sent to anyone in the Slack workspace. DMs are typically used for private communications or communications that do not require ongoing conversation.
If you have an ongoing need for a DM group then you may want to consider creating a specific channel for that purpose.
Can I customize my Slack?
Yes we recommend everyone customize their slack to their liking. You can do this by opening the preferences page within Slack.
You can customize the look and feel with "Themes" as well as what will appear on the sidebar of your Slack Menu.
We also recommend you organize your channels as needed by created channel categories in the sidebar or by "starring" channels that you use most frequently.
What does "@channel" mean?
When a message is written in a slack channel which includes "@channel" it will notify everyone in that channel of the message.
You can also "@" specific people to notify them without notifying the whole channel.
What is a thread?
You can create a thread underneath a Slack message by clicking on that message and choosing "reply in thread".
This will create a conversation under the original message rather than adding more messages to the main area of the channel.
We recommend using threads when having an ongoing conversation about a message in a Slack channel so that multiple conversations can happen at the same time without overlapping and causing confusion to people int he channel.
